11. Re: trouble using password verify as in booking example
gavin.king Feb 1, 2007 4:40 AM (in response to henrik.lindberg)Is getVerify()/setVerify() on the local interface?
-
12. Re: trouble using password verify as in booking example
henrik.lindberg Feb 1, 2007 5:14 AM (in response to henrik.lindberg)Local interface did not have getVerify() nor setVerify() declared - and... the example Local interface has these.
My mistake.
Thanks Gavin !!!
Getting a better error message would have helped a newbie a lot - the initial "can not convert..." that I got was quite confusing.
But hey! problem solved. Thanks again.
